Skip to content
Snippets Groups Projects
Commit f884a337 authored by Eoin Clerkin's avatar Eoin Clerkin
Browse files

Adds a beam pipe

adds default beam pipe geometry used in conjunction with the MUCH
parent 86ab34d9
No related branches found
No related tags found
No related merge requests found
<?xml version="1.0"?>
<gdml x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="http://service-spi.web.cern.ch/service-spi/app/releases/GDML/schema/gdml.xsd">
<define>
<position name="pipe1_0inpipe_v20a_1mpos" x="0" y="0" z="0" unit="cm"/>
<position name="pipe2_0inpipe_v20a_1mpos" x="0" y="0" z="0" unit="cm"/>
<position name="pipevac1_0inpipe_v20a_1mpos" x="0" y="0" z="0" unit="cm"/>
<position name="pipe3_0inpipe_v20a_1mpos" x="0" y="0" z="0" unit="cm"/>
<position name="pipevac3_0inpipe_v20a_1mpos" x="0" y="0" z="0" unit="cm"/>
<position name="pipe4_0inpipe_v20a_1mpos" x="0" y="0" z="0" unit="cm"/>
<position name="pipe5_0inpipevac4pos" x="-1.4583740234405065" y="0" z="0" unit="cm"/>
<rotation name="pipe5_0inpipevac4rot" x="0" y="-1" z="0" unit="deg"/>
<position name="pipevac5_0inpipevac4pos" x="-1.4583740234405065" y="0" z="0" unit="cm"/>
<rotation name="pipevac5_0inpipevac4rot" x="0" y="-1" z="0" unit="deg"/>
<position name="pipevac6_0inpipevac4pos" x="5" y="0" z="0" unit="cm"/>
<position name="pipevac4_0inpipe_v20a_1mpos" x="0" y="0" z="0" unit="cm"/>
<position name="pipe7_0inpipe_v20a_1mpos" x="-1.4583740234405065" y="0" z="0" unit="cm"/>
<rotation name="pipe7_0inpipe_v20a_1mrot" x="0" y="-1" z="0" unit="deg"/>
<position name="pipevac7_0inpipe_v20a_1mpos" x="-1.4583740234405065" y="0" z="0" unit="cm"/>
<rotation name="pipevac7_0inpipe_v20a_1mrot" x="0" y="-1" z="0" unit="deg"/>
<position name="pipe8_0inpipe_v20a_1mpos" x="-1.4583740234405065" y="0" z="0" unit="cm"/>
<rotation name="pipe8_0inpipe_v20a_1mrot" x="0" y="-1" z="0" unit="deg"/>
<position name="pipe_v20a_1m_1inTOPpos" x="0" y="0" z="0" unit="cm"/>
</define>
<materials>
<material name="carbon" Z="6">
<D unit="g/cm3" value="2.2650000000000001"/>
<atom unit="g/mole" value="12.010999999999999"/>
</material>
<material name="iron" Z="26">
<D unit="g/cm3" value="7.8700000000000001"/>
<atom unit="g/mole" value="55.847000000000001"/>
</material>
<material name="vacuum" Z="1">
<D unit="g/cm3" value="9.9999999999999998e-17"/>
<atom unit="g/mole" value="9.9999999999999998e-17"/>
</material>
</materials>
<solids>
<polycone name="TGeoPcon" startphi="0" deltaphi="360" aunit="deg" lunit="cm">
<zplane z="-5" rmin="2.5" rmax="2.5699999999999998"/>
<zplane z="-0.5" rmin="2.5" rmax="2.5699999999999998"/>
<zplane z="-0.5" rmin="2.5699999999999998" rmax="40"/>
<zplane z="-0.5" rmin="40" rmax="40.07"/>
<zplane z="23.016999999999999" rmin="40" rmax="40.07"/>
<zplane z="23.016999999999999" rmin="11" rmax="40.07"/>
<zplane z="23.087" rmin="11" rmax="13.069999999999999"/>
</polycone>
<polycone name="TGeoPcon0x1" startphi="0" deltaphi="360" aunit="deg" lunit="cm">
<zplane z="22" rmin="1.8" rmax="1.8"/>
<zplane z="22.07" rmin="1.8" rmax="2.8690000000000002"/>
<zplane z="22.145" rmin="3" rmax="3.9299999999999997"/>
<zplane z="22.371000000000002" rmin="6" rmax="6.5549999999999997"/>
<zplane z="22.749000000000002" rmin="9" rmax="9.4139999999999997"/>
<zplane z="23.016999999999999" rmin="10.586" rmax="11"/>
<zplane z="23.087" rmin="11" rmax="11"/>
</polycone>
<polycone name="TGeoPcon0x2" startphi="0" deltaphi="360" aunit="deg" lunit="cm">
<zplane z="-5" rmin="0" rmax="2.5"/>
<zplane z="-0.5" rmin="0" rmax="2.5"/>
<zplane z="-0.5" rmin="0" rmax="40"/>
<zplane z="22" rmin="0" rmax="40"/>
<zplane z="22" rmin="1.8" rmax="40"/>
<zplane z="22.07" rmin="2.8690000000000002" rmax="40"/>
<zplane z="22.145" rmin="3.9299999999999997" rmax="40"/>
<zplane z="22.371000000000002" rmin="6.5549999999999997" rmax="40"/>
<zplane z="22.749000000000002" rmin="9.4139999999999997" rmax="40"/>
<zplane z="23.016999999999999" rmin="11" rmax="40"/>
</polycone>
<polycone name="TGeoPcon0x3" startphi="0" deltaphi="360" aunit="deg" lunit="cm">
<zplane z="22" rmin="1.75" rmax="1.8"/>
<zplane z="50" rmin="1.75" rmax="1.8"/>
<zplane z="125" rmin="5.4500000000000002" rmax="5.5"/>
<zplane z="170" rmin="7.3700000000000001" rmax="7.4199999999999999"/>
</polycone>
<polycone name="TGeoPcon0x4" startphi="0" deltaphi="360" aunit="deg" lunit="cm">
<zplane z="22" rmin="0" rmax="1.75"/>
<zplane z="50" rmin="0" rmax="1.75"/>
<zplane z="125" rmin="0" rmax="5.4500000000000002"/>
<zplane z="170" rmin="0" rmax="7.3700000000000001"/>
</polycone>
<polycone name="TGeoPcon0x5" startphi="0" deltaphi="360" aunit="deg" lunit="cm">
<zplane z="170" rmin="7.2720000000000002" rmax="7.4199999999999999"/>
<zplane z="370" rmin="15.790000000000001" rmax="16.109999999999999"/>
</polycone>
<polycone name="TGeoPcon0x6" startphi="0" deltaphi="360" aunit="deg" lunit="cm">
<zplane z="170" rmin="0" rmax="7.2720000000000002"/>
<zplane z="370" rmin="0" rmax="15.790000000000001"/>
</polycone>
<polycone name="TGeoPcon0x7" startphi="0" deltaphi="360" aunit="deg" lunit="cm">
<zplane z="370.19999999999999" rmin="9.4499999999999993" rmax="9.5"/>
<zplane z="900" rmin="9.4499999999999993" rmax="9.5"/>
</polycone>
<polycone name="TGeoPcon0x8" startphi="0" deltaphi="360" aunit="deg" lunit="cm">
<zplane z="370.19999999999999" rmin="0" rmax="9.4499999999999993"/>
<zplane z="900" rmin="0" rmax="9.4499999999999993"/>
</polycone>
<polycone name="TGeoPcon0x9" startphi="0" deltaphi="360" aunit="deg" lunit="cm">
<zplane z="370.19999999999999" rmin="0" rmax="9.5"/>
<zplane z="370.21999999999997" rmin="0" rmax="9.5"/>
</polycone>
<polycone name="TGeoPcon0x10" startphi="0" deltaphi="360" aunit="deg" lunit="cm">
<zplane z="900.0200000000001" rmin="9.4499999999999993" rmax="9.5"/>
<zplane z="1900" rmin="9.4499999999999993" rmax="9.5"/>
</polycone>
<polycone name="TGeoPcon0x11" startphi="0" deltaphi="360" aunit="deg" lunit="cm">
<zplane z="900.0200000000001" rmin="0" rmax="9.4499999999999993"/>
<zplane z="1900" rmin="0" rmax="9.4499999999999993"/>
</polycone>
<polycone name="TGeoPcon0x12" startphi="0" deltaphi="360" aunit="deg" lunit="cm">
<zplane z="1900" rmin="0" rmax="9.5"/>
<zplane z="1900.02" rmin="0" rmax="9.5"/>
</polycone>
</solids>
<structure>
<volume name="pipe1">
<materialref ref="carbon"/>
<solidref ref="TGeoPcon"/>
</volume>
<volume name="pipe2">
<materialref ref="carbon"/>
<solidref ref="TGeoPcon0x1"/>
</volume>
<volume name="pipevac1">
<materialref ref="vacuum"/>
<solidref ref="TGeoPcon0x2"/>
</volume>
<volume name="pipe3">
<materialref ref="carbon"/>
<solidref ref="TGeoPcon0x3"/>
</volume>
<volume name="pipevac3">
<materialref ref="vacuum"/>
<solidref ref="TGeoPcon0x4"/>
</volume>
<volume name="pipe4">
<materialref ref="carbon"/>
<solidref ref="TGeoPcon0x5"/>
</volume>
<volume name="pipe5">
<materialref ref="carbon"/>
<solidref ref="TGeoPcon0x7"/>
</volume>
<volume name="pipevac5">
<materialref ref="vacuum"/>
<solidref ref="TGeoPcon0x8"/>
</volume>
<volume name="pipevac6">
<materialref ref="vacuum"/>
<solidref ref="TGeoPcon0x9"/>
</volume>
<volume name="pipevac4">
<materialref ref="vacuum"/>
<solidref ref="TGeoPcon0x6"/>
<physvol name="pipe5_0" copynumber="0">
<volumeref ref="pipe5"/>
<positionref ref="pipe5_0inpipevac4pos"/>
<rotationref ref="pipe5_0inpipevac4rot"/>
</physvol>
<physvol name="pipevac5_0" copynumber="0">
<volumeref ref="pipevac5"/>
<positionref ref="pipevac5_0inpipevac4pos"/>
<rotationref ref="pipevac5_0inpipevac4rot"/>
</physvol>
<physvol name="pipevac6_0" copynumber="0">
<volumeref ref="pipevac6"/>
<positionref ref="pipevac6_0inpipevac4pos"/>
</physvol>
</volume>
<volume name="pipe7">
<materialref ref="carbon"/>
<solidref ref="TGeoPcon0x10"/>
</volume>
<volume name="pipevac7">
<materialref ref="vacuum"/>
<solidref ref="TGeoPcon0x11"/>
</volume>
<volume name="pipe8">
<materialref ref="iron"/>
<solidref ref="TGeoPcon0x12"/>
</volume>
<assembly name="pipe_v20a_1m">
<physvol name="pipe1_0" copynumber="0">
<volumeref ref="pipe1"/>
<positionref ref="pipe1_0inpipe_v20a_1mpos"/>
</physvol>
<physvol name="pipe2_0" copynumber="0">
<volumeref ref="pipe2"/>
<positionref ref="pipe2_0inpipe_v20a_1mpos"/>
</physvol>
<physvol name="pipevac1_0" copynumber="0">
<volumeref ref="pipevac1"/>
<positionref ref="pipevac1_0inpipe_v20a_1mpos"/>
</physvol>
<physvol name="pipe3_0" copynumber="0">
<volumeref ref="pipe3"/>
<positionref ref="pipe3_0inpipe_v20a_1mpos"/>
</physvol>
<physvol name="pipevac3_0" copynumber="0">
<volumeref ref="pipevac3"/>
<positionref ref="pipevac3_0inpipe_v20a_1mpos"/>
</physvol>
<physvol name="pipe4_0" copynumber="0">
<volumeref ref="pipe4"/>
<positionref ref="pipe4_0inpipe_v20a_1mpos"/>
</physvol>
<physvol name="pipevac4_0" copynumber="0">
<volumeref ref="pipevac4"/>
<positionref ref="pipevac4_0inpipe_v20a_1mpos"/>
</physvol>
<physvol name="pipe7_0" copynumber="0">
<volumeref ref="pipe7"/>
<positionref ref="pipe7_0inpipe_v20a_1mpos"/>
<rotationref ref="pipe7_0inpipe_v20a_1mrot"/>
</physvol>
<physvol name="pipevac7_0" copynumber="0">
<volumeref ref="pipevac7"/>
<positionref ref="pipevac7_0inpipe_v20a_1mpos"/>
<rotationref ref="pipevac7_0inpipe_v20a_1mrot"/>
</physvol>
<physvol name="pipe8_0" copynumber="0">
<volumeref ref="pipe8"/>
<positionref ref="pipe8_0inpipe_v20a_1mpos"/>
<rotationref ref="pipe8_0inpipe_v20a_1mrot"/>
</physvol>
</assembly>
<assembly name="TOP">
<physvol name="pipe_v20a_1m_1" copynumber="1">
<volumeref ref="pipe_v20a_1m"/>
<positionref ref="pipe_v20a_1m_1inTOPpos"/>
</physvol>
</assembly>
</structure>
<setup name="default" version="1.0">
<world ref="TOP"/>
</setup>
</gdml>
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ment